Lysander (d. 395 B.C.) was a Greek general in the service of Sparta; as a leader in the Peloponnesian War, he defeated the forces of Athens in several naval battles. Eventually forces lead by him conquered the city of Athens, successfully installing Sparta as the leading city-state in the Greek peninsula.
